Port-xen archive

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]

more UDP packet loss?



Hi all,

some other people have reported UDP packet loss between domU and dom0
(in bridge mode) but I understood that has mostly been under high
traffic load? I seem to get loss also with no load at all.

Every time I start a domU I see lost DHCP replies and lots of NFS
retransmits. This is for a domU with root on NFS but I get the DHCP
problems also for a domU on local disk. At the same time the other
running domU:s seem to "freeze". After the domU is started it uses NFS
over TCP and that seems to work better.

Below are packet captures during boot, up to the NFS mount root
call. The DHCP offers come back from the DHCP server on physical wm0
but the first 7 never reaches the domU XVIF interface. Netstat shows
no packet loss.

This is on a 8GB Quad core Xeon system - with zero CPU load in dom0
and a couple of other domUs. Week old -current amd64 dom0.

I tried increasing the UDP send/receive buffers in dom0 but it made no
difference.

Any ideas?
    -- Urban

domU xvif:
No.     Time            Source                Destination           Protocol 
Info
      1 11:01:36.718159 0.0.0.0               255.255.255.255       DHCP     
DHCP Discover - Transaction ID 0x1ffffff
      2 11:01:37.718119 0.0.0.0               255.255.255.255       DHCP     
DHCP Discover - Transaction ID 0x1ffffff
      4 11:01:39.718100 0.0.0.0               255.255.255.255       DHCP     
DHCP Discover - Transaction ID 0x1ffffff
      6 11:01:42.718037 0.0.0.0               255.255.255.255       DHCP     
DHCP Discover - Transaction ID 0x1ffffff
      7 11:01:46.717970 0.0.0.0               255.255.255.255       DHCP     
DHCP Discover - Transaction ID 0x1ffffff
      8 11:01:51.717910 0.0.0.0               255.255.255.255       DHCP     
DHCP Discover - Transaction ID 0x1ffffff
      9 11:01:56.717828 0.0.0.0               255.255.255.255       DHCP     
DHCP Discover - Transaction ID 0x1ffffff
     12 11:02:01.717769 0.0.0.0               255.255.255.255       DHCP     
DHCP Discover - Transaction ID 0x1ffffff
     13 11:02:01.719371 192.168.1.27          192.168.1.29          DHCP     
DHCP Offer    - Transaction ID 0x1ffffff
     14 11:02:01.719409 0.0.0.0               255.255.255.255       DHCP     
DHCP Request  - Transaction ID 0x1ffffff
     15 11:02:01.720906 192.168.1.27          192.168.1.29          DHCP     
DHCP ACK      - Transaction ID 0x1ffffff
     16 11:02:01.721083 Xensourc_2c:68:57     Broadcast             ARP      
Gratuitous ARP for 192.168.1.29 (Request)
     25 11:02:04.717719 Xensourc_2c:68:57     Broadcast             ARP      
Who has 192.168.1.43?  Tell 192.168.1.29
     26 11:02:04.718361 Asiarock_f5:2c:a0     Xensourc_2c:68:57     ARP      
192.168.1.43 is at 00:0b:6a:f5:2c:a0
     27 11:02:04.718381 192.168.1.29          192.168.1.43          Portmap  V2 
GETPORT Call (Reply In 28) MOUNT(100005) V:3 UDP

physical wm0:
No.     Time            Source                Destination           Protocol 
Info
      1 11:01:36.718167 0.0.0.0               255.255.255.255       DHCP     
DHCP Discover - Transaction ID 0x1ffffff
      2 11:01:36.719828 192.168.1.27          192.168.1.29          DHCP     
DHCP Offer    - Transaction ID 0x1ffffff
      3 11:01:37.718125 0.0.0.0               255.255.255.255       DHCP     
DHCP Discover - Transaction ID 0x1ffffff
      4 11:01:37.719748 192.168.1.27          192.168.1.29          DHCP     
DHCP Offer    - Transaction ID 0x1ffffff
      5 11:01:39.718106 0.0.0.0               255.255.255.255       DHCP     
DHCP Discover - Transaction ID 0x1ffffff
      6 11:01:39.719587 192.168.1.27          192.168.1.29          DHCP     
DHCP Offer    - Transaction ID 0x1ffffff
      7 11:01:42.718043 0.0.0.0               255.255.255.255       DHCP     
DHCP Discover - Transaction ID 0x1ffffff
      8 11:01:42.719348 192.168.1.27          192.168.1.29          DHCP     
DHCP Offer    - Transaction ID 0x1ffffff
      9 11:01:46.717975 0.0.0.0               255.255.255.255       DHCP     
DHCP Discover - Transaction ID 0x1ffffff
     10 11:01:46.719411 192.168.1.27          192.168.1.29          DHCP     
DHCP Offer    - Transaction ID 0x1ffffff
     11 11:01:51.717915 0.0.0.0               255.255.255.255       DHCP     
DHCP Discover - Transaction ID 0x1ffffff
     12 11:01:51.719779 192.168.1.27          192.168.1.29          DHCP     
DHCP Offer    - Transaction ID 0x1ffffff
     13 11:01:56.717901 0.0.0.0               255.255.255.255       DHCP     
DHCP Discover - Transaction ID 0x1ffffff
     14 11:01:56.719762 192.168.1.27          192.168.1.29          DHCP     
DHCP Offer    - Transaction ID 0x1ffffff
     15 11:02:01.717836 0.0.0.0               255.255.255.255       DHCP     
DHCP Discover - Transaction ID 0x1ffffff
     16 11:02:01.719363 192.168.1.27          192.168.1.29          DHCP     
DHCP Offer    - Transaction ID 0x1ffffff
     17 11:02:01.719413 0.0.0.0               255.255.255.255       DHCP     
DHCP Request  - Transaction ID 0x1ffffff
     18 11:02:01.720899 192.168.1.27          192.168.1.29          DHCP     
DHCP ACK      - Transaction ID 0x1ffffff
     19 11:02:01.721147 Xensourc_2c:68:57     Broadcast             ARP      
Gratuitous ARP for 192.168.1.29 (Request)
     20 11:02:04.717723 Xensourc_2c:68:57     Broadcast             ARP      
Who has 192.168.1.43?  Tell 192.168.1.29
     21 11:02:04.718354 Asiarock_f5:2c:a0     Xensourc_2c:68:57     ARP      
192.168.1.43 is at 00:0b:6a:f5:2c:a0
     22 11:02:04.718384 192.168.1.29          192.168.1.43          Portmap  V2 
GETPORT Call (Reply In 23) MOUNT(100005) V:3 UDP


Home | Main Index | Thread Index | Old Index